Transaction 0caae378f2391e715ac5dfd6de6cd89a43f4592200ceca89a5ba47febc320f14

1 Input
2 Outputs
  • 0caae378f2391e715ac5dfd6de6cd89a43f4592200ceca89a5ba47febc320f14:0
  • value  12706710230
    address  1CDPoCHj7ybWutTzCXzvu3hBr6fJ2cFCQi
  • 0caae378f2391e715ac5dfd6de6cd89a43f4592200ceca89a5ba47febc320f14:1
  • value  577077063
    address  1Fb5t4YgzgcpJfR5E3RHM7Cy7P8xnDvNLJ